site stats

Branched instructions

WebJun 2, 2024 · 317k 45 583 818. Add a comment. 3. It means, you had penalty between the cycles of the processor. Every processor has cycles of operation, each delay in the cycle will result in a penalty, as it waits until the branch executes in the ALU or: Branch penalty in pipeline results from non-zero distance between ALU and IF. WebDec 14, 2024 · The BRNE (branch if not equal) instruction uses the Z flag in the status register. Write a program to add 5 to R20 20 times and send the sum to PORTC using the BRNE instruction. LDI R16, 20; counter register LDI R20, 0 LDI R21, 5 LOOP: ADD R20, R21 DEC R16; decrement the counter BRNE LOOP; repeat until counter = 0 OUT …

MIPS Assembly/Instruction Formats - Wikibooks

WebJul 5, 2024 · Branches (or jumps) 1 are one of the most common instruction types. Statistically, every fifth instruction is a branch. Branches change the execution flow of … WebA branch instruction computes the target address in one of fourways: Target address is the sum of a constant and the address of thebranch instruction itself. Target address is the … city of griffin ga utilities https://appuna.com

Branch Instructions - John Loomis

WebBranches typically used for loops (if-else, while, for) Loops are generally small (< 50 instructions) Function calls and unconditional jumps handled with jump instructions (J-Format) Recall: Instructions stored in a localized area of memory (Code/Text) Largest branch distance limited by size of code Address of current instruction stored in the program WebA3.3 Branch instructions All ARM processors support a branch instruction that allows a conditional branch forwards or backwards up to 32MB. As the PC is one of the general … WebApr 27, 2024 · Branching instructions refer to the act of switching execution to a different instruction sequence as a result of executing a branch instruction. 1. Jump … don\u0027t cross the line movie

Handling Control Hazards – Computer Architecture - UMD

Category:Branch Instructions in AVR Microcontroller - GeeksforGeeks

Tags:Branched instructions

Branched instructions

Handling Control Hazards – Computer Architecture - UMD

WebBranch Instructions. The basic mechanism for control flow on almost any computer is the set of branch instructions ( there are exceptions - notably the MIPS and the DEC Alpha … WebBranches are used in controlling the order in which instructions are executed. The disassembly for the branch routine illustrates several if statements. The example …

Branched instructions

Did you know?

WebThese inspection instructions are specifically developed by the Fresh Products Branch to assist officially licensed inspectors in the interpretation and application of the U.S. Standards for Grades of Fresh Peas, Section 51.1375. These instructions do not establish any substantial rule not legally authorized by the official grade standards. http://6502.org/tutorials/6502opcodes.html

http://cs107e.github.io/readings/armisa.pdf WebApr 24, 2024 · 3.2 An Algorithm for Two-Way Loop. Various issues/simultaneous instructions executions of branch and straight path of loops is supported by two-way loop algorithm [].Three main things are achieved by the TWL algorithm and these include transforms of control dependences into data dependences, increasing in parallelism …

WebJan 2, 2024 · These branch instructions are extremely common and can make up roughly 20% of all instructions in a program. On the surface, these branch instructions may not seem like an issue, but they can ... Web7.8.4 Translating branch instructions to machine code. Now that the method of calculating the branch offsets for the branch instructions has been explained, the following program shows an example of calculating the branch offsets in a program. Note that in this example the trick of dropping the last two bits of the address will be used, so …

Mechanically, a branch instruction can change the program counter of a CPU. The program counter stores the memory address of the next instruction to be executed. Therefore, a branch can cause the CPU to begin fetching its instructions from a different sequence of memory cells. Machine level branch … See more There are three types of branching instructions in computer organization: 1. Jump Instructions The jump instruction transfers the program sequence to the memory address given in the operand based on the … See more Branch instructions can handle in several ways to reduce their negative impact on the rate of execution of instructions. 1. Branch delay slot The processor fetches the next instructions before it determines whether the current … See more

WebThe Analyze, Design, Develop, Implement, and Evaluate (ADDIE) process is used to introduce an approach to instruction design that has a proven record of success. … city of griffin ga waterWebBranch addressing format • Need Opcode, one or two registers, and an offset – No base register since offset added to PC • When using one register (i.e., compare to 0), can use … city of griffin ga tax commissionerWebRobert Maribe Branch is a tenured Professor of Instructional Design and Technology at the University of Georgia. Rob earned an Associate degree from New York City Technical College in Brooklyn, New York; a Bachelor of Science degree from Elizabeth City State University, North Carolina; and a Masters degree from Ball State University in Muncie, … city of griffin ga zoningWebNov 6, 2024 · 360 Assembly/Branch Instructions. The branch instructions for the 360 Series mainframe computer come in two types: instructions which branch where a return … don\u0027t cross the river america chordsWebThe increased branch range makes it easier to manage inter-section jumps. Dynamically generated code is generally placed on the heap so it can, in practice, be located … city of griffin hiperwebWebInspection Instructions January 2006 . Shipping Point and Market Inspection Instructions for Sweet Anise, Parsnips, ... Reference to "General Inspection Instructions" in all Fresh Products Branch publications refers to any one or all of the following - General Shipping Point Inspection Instructions, General Market Inspection Instructions, or ... city of griffin georgia utilitiesWebThese inspection instructions are specifically developed by the Fresh Products Branch to assist officially licensed inspectors in the interpretation and application of the U.S. Standards for Grades of Brussels Sprouts, Section 51.2250. These instructions do not establish any substantial rule not legally authorized by the official grade standards. don\u0027t crush med list